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Be aware of the following signs that show you need Attic Water Ext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ture or mold in your attic.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ls can show water damage in your attic.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Peeling Paint or Warped Wood

Peeling paint or warped wood can be a sign of moisture or water damage in your attic.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.

Unusual Sounds or Puddles

Unusual sounds or puddles in your attic can show a leak or water damage. Don’t hesitate to contact us if you notice any of these signs.

Attic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in attic with minimal water damage Yes No You can handle small leaks and clean up yourself.
Large leak or extensive water damage No Yes Professional help is required to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es A professional can help you identify the source and provide a solution.
Attic insulation damaged or compromised No Yes Professional help is required to replace or repair damaged insulation.
Health concerns or mold growth No Yes Professional help is required to ensure safety and prevent further health risks.
Time-sensitive situation or emergency No Yes Professional help is required to respond quickly and effectively.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Van Alstyne, TX

The cost of Attic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of debris, and equipment used.
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and labor required.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$500 Size of affected area and equipment used.
